Output 3e954553853a8f225497682b30b571cdcfc3f5ca321b20da9781ec8c1965e17b:0

value
21178087
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ff933f644a852bd5bc38b7cf5a797fc83ff6c0aa OP_EQUALVERIFY OP_CHECKSIG
address
1QJMhrwXqP3BnKjFoHPNUNucHKPBswQ3XK
transaction
3e954553853a8f225497682b30b571cdcfc3f5ca321b20da9781ec8c1965e17b
spent
true